B-24 Computer Control
The Get Minimum Kinetic Interval (‘$‘) command is defined as follows:
Host Response
'$' <ACK/NAK>
Reader response protocol (hex format):
interval low byte,0x00 0xFF
interval high byte,0x00 0xFF
The Get Minimum Kinetic Interval command then returns the standard status
response string.
Intervals are returned in units of seconds. Minimum kinetic intervals are calculated
based on a number of different variables, including but not limited to the user’s
selection of strip(s), wavelength(s), shake time, and baud rate.
The host PC should ensure that all reader setup commands have been sent for the
upcoming read before requesting the minimum kinetic interval (filter configuration,
assay definition with or without multi-wavelength setup, strip range selection, etc.).
